Review of the Stockpoint Cryptocurrency Exchange / Stockpoint

Stockpoint is a modern cryptocurrency exchange, officially registered in Slovakia and having everything needed for fast and convenient execution of cryptocurrency transactions between users around the world. The simplicity of the Stockpoint cryptocurrency exchange will allow ordinary users to easily carry out the exchange or purchase of the cryptocurrency they need, while for experienced traders it will be a convenient and functional tool for earning on cryptocurrency trading.
Cryptocurrency Mining Using a Smartphone

Crypto technologies are gradually changing the world and are increasingly being implemented in mobile communication devices. Thus, the British digital payments company Electroneum has presented the M1 smartphone, with which the smartphone's owner will be able to mine the ETN cryptocurrency, which can be used for various purposes, such as topping up mobile data, online shopping and other online services...
A Vulnerability Discovered in the Ledger Nano S Crypto Wallet

A bug has been discovered in the Ledger Nano S hardware crypto wallet in the operation of software version 1.1.3 with the Monero 0.14 client, related to an incorrect address for the return of funds. This was reported by the developers of the Ledger Nano S cryptocurrency wallet, who asked device owners to refrain from using version 0.14 while the developers search for a solution.
Binance Coin (BNB) Has Overtaken TRON and Stellar

On February 20, Binance launched testing of the Binance DEX decentralized trading platform on its own blockchain, whose token is Binance Coin (BNB) . This contributed to the growth of the Binance Coin cryptocurrency, and in just two days Binance Coin overtook two coins — TRON and Stellar, and now ranks eighth by market capitalization in the cryptocurrency rankings.
A Vulnerability Discovered in the Coinomi Crypto Wallet

Programmer Warith Al Maawali has discovered a security breach in the Coinomi cryptocurrency wallet, as a result of which the Coinomi crypto wallet sends users' passphrases to the Google spell-check service in unencrypted form, thereby opening up access for scammers to private information and giving them the opportunity to take over users' funds. This breach in the wallet's security was discovered during the investigation of the mysterious theft of 90% of the programmer's funds.
